About This Event
This online continuing nursing education conference provides an overview of advancements in geriatric care, covering topics such as dementia management, ethics, women's health, effective communication, and sleep. The program features expert panels, case scenarios, and practical guidance for healthcare professionals caring for elderly patient populations.
